**Job Summary:**
The DTC - Viewer Experience (VX) team is seeking a Salesforce & Integrations QA. In this role, you will support VX's Salesforce platform by developing and executing automated and manual test plans. The ideal candidate has a deep understanding of Salesforce's features, capabilities, and best practices, as well as a passion for maintaining quality solutions.
In this role, you are expected to partner with various departments, including Enterprise, Product, Engineering, IT, Operations, Data, and InfoSec, to coordinate initiatives that deliver on Disney DTC's business goals and objectives.
The right person for this role has experience performing comprehensive testing on Salesforce applications to ensure functionality, performance, and security. If you are passionate about technology and transforming service experiences, this is a great role for you!
**Responsibilities and Duties of the Role:**
Translate acceptance criteria into functional test cases to ensure all requirements are met and develop comprehensive and relevant test cases that cover various scenarios, including positive, negative, and regression cases
Perform test execution and defect reporting utilizing testing tools. Monitor and track traceability of business requirements/stories to tests executed.
Analyze, track, report, test and help resolve production problems
Work with internal and external partners to deliver backlog requests and projects in iterative release cycles and conducts ongoing testing and validation to ensure the stability of the VX applications
Replicate production issues in a lower environment to help troubleshoot and assist with root cause analysis and triage of key / critical defects for quick turn-around
Prototype emerging technologies and maintain quality solutions to create best-in-class service experiences for viewers and advocates

**Job Title: Quality Assurance Specialist**
Job Description
As a Quality Assurance Specialist, you will perform and document inspections to ensure compliance with specified standards. You will act as a liaison between production and the quality department, address quality-related concerns, and maintain high-quality standards throughout the manufacturing process.
Responsibilities
+ Perform and document first-piece, coil change, and in-process inspections.
+ Serve as a liaison between production supervisors, operators, and the quality department.
+ Identify, document, and control non-conforming products.
+ Record and analyze production line scrap to improve efficiency.
+ Support manufacturing activities to maintain seamless operations.
+ Distribute shop floor documents accurately and timely.
+ Maintain accurate records to meet regulatory and company standards.
+ Participate in root cause analysis and implement corrective actions.
+ Engage in continuous improvement projects.
+ Assist with First Article Inspections (FAIs) and customer-specific validations.
+ Support gauge maintenance tasks, including calibration and verification.
+ Perform statistical analysis to monitor process performance.
+ Operate Coordinate Measuring Machines (CMM) and other precision inspection tools.
